Replacement right wheel module designed for Roborock Qrevo Pro and Qrevo S robotic vacuum cleaners. This original-equivalent spare part restores mobility and steering when the right wheel assembly becomes damaged, worn, or unresponsive. The module is intended for direct replacement of the drive wheel on compatible Roborock models to recover normal navigation and ensure the robot moves smoothly across floor surfaces.
The right wheel module provides a precise fit with Roborock Qrevo Pro and Qrevo S drive housings, enabling reliable wheel rotation and steering after installation. It is manufactured to match the functional and dimensional characteristics of the original assembly, helping to minimise downtime and avoid the need to replace the entire robot. Using a like-for-like replacement preserves the vacuum’s navigation accuracy and drive performance.
Power off the robot and remove it from the charging dock before beginning the replacement. Access the right wheel assembly by following the device service instructions for your Qrevo model: typically this involves removing a cover or wheel housing to expose the wheel module connection. Detach the defective module by disconnecting any electrical connectors and fasteners, then install the replacement module in the same orientation, secure all fasteners, and reconnect electrical contacts. After reassembly, place the robot on a flat surface, power it on, and run a short drive or calibration routine to confirm correct operation and steering response.
Use only when compatible with the listed models and ensure connectors and fasteners are fully seated during installation. Inspect the left wheel and other drive components for wear at the same time; replacing both sides or related parts may improve balance and navigation. If uncertain about disassembly, consult an authorised service provider to avoid damage to the robot.
